Distribution & Habitat:

Madagascan rainforest.

Description:

A large, solitary palm with a thick trunk, orange crownshaft, and long slightly plumose leaves. Similar in appearance to Dypsis pilulifera

General:

Another Dypsis only known from cultivated specimens.

Culture:

Sunny, moist, but well drained position. Fairly slow growing.
